  • Publication number: 20020187386
    Abstract: A first unit cell of a fuel cell stack has a first joint body sandwiched between a first separator and a second separator. The second separator has a first metal sheet having a region where grooves and ridges alternate with each other and a second metal sheet having a region where grooves and ridges alternate with each other, and a leaf spring interposed between the first and second metal sheets. The leaf spring is held against crests of the ridges of the first and second metal sheets. The grooves of the first metal sheet face the ridges of the second metal sheet across the leaf spring, and the ridges of the first metal sheet face the grooves of the second metal sheet across the leaf spring.

  • Patent number: 6026789
    Abstract: A regulator for compressed natural gas is prevented from being frozen and from being heated to higher than a degree appropriate for prevention of the freezing.A hot-water passage 11 for circulating a portion of the engine cooling water is provided adjacent to a gas passage 24 equipped with a reducing valve 21 in the primary decompression section A of the regulator. A hot-water outlet member 10 is provided at the outlet aperture of the hot-water passage 11. A temperature sensitive valve 42 is mounted in the hot-water outlet member 10 and is set so that the hot-water passage 11 is closed with the valve body 48 when the temperature of the hot-water exceeds the degree appropriate for prevention of the freeze at the outlet aperture.
